Muscadet Sèvre et Maine, Dom. de l'Aurière - 2009

White, France, Loire, Nantes

A light-bodied, dry white wine from the Nantais region of the Loire Valley. The cuisine in this region tends to be centered around seafood - oysters, smoked fish, and the like. Naturally, this sort of white wine is a perfect match for such tangy, briny fare.

Carignan, Poudou - 2008

Red, France, Languedoc-Roussillon, Coteaux de Peyriac

In France, the red Carignan grape is typically used in blends. This is a rare monovarietal Carignan bottling, and it clearly expresses the classic profile of this ancient grape. It is unoaked, full-bodied, and dry, with aromas of dark berries and ripe, rustic tannins.
